STM32 microcontroller variable frequency amplitude DDS signal generator sine wave triangle wave square wave AD9833

Practice making DIY- GC 00 94 - DDS signal generator

1. Function description:

Design based on STM32 microcontroller - DDS signal generator

  • Features:

Hardware composition: STM32F103C series minimum system board + LCD1602 display + AD9833 signal module + 4*4 matrix keyboard + multiple keys

1. Set the frequency value and the amplitude of the triangular wave and sine wave through the 4*4 keyboard (the amplitude of the square wave cannot be set to a fixed 4V amplitude), and the frequency setting range is 0~0.99999MHz. Amplitude setting range 0~3.3V (below 100mV waveform will be distorted, not recommended to be lower than 100mV)

2. Select the output waveform range through the 4*4 keyboard: three models of sine wave, square wave and triangle wave can be set

3. Details:

Video explanation: Bilibili searches for the UP master "love to engage in single-chip microcomputer" and searches for the keyword " DDS signal generator " in its space to watch the detailed explanation of the video

 

Function demonstration operation :

This is a DDS signal generator based on STM32 microcontroller . Hardware composition: STM32F103C series minimum system board + LCD1602 display + AD9833 signal module + 4*4 matrix keyboard + multiple keys

1. Set the frequency value and the amplitude of the triangular wave and sine wave through the 4*4 keyboard (the amplitude of the square wave cannot be set to a fixed 4V amplitude), and the frequency setting range is 0~0.99999MHz. Amplitude setting range 0~3.3V (below 100mV waveform will be distorted, not recommended to be lower than 100mV)

2. Select the output waveform range through the 4*4 keyboard: three models of sine wave, square wave and triangle wave can be set

Hardware composition: STM32F103C series minimum system board + LCD1602 display + AD9833 signal module + 4*4 matrix keyboard + multiple keys

1. Set the frequency value and the amplitude of the triangular wave and sine wave through the 4*4 keyboard (the amplitude of the square wave cannot be set to a fixed 4V amplitude), and the frequency setting range is 0~0.99999MHz. Amplitude setting range 0~3.3V (below 100mV waveform will be distorted, not recommended to be lower than 100mV)

2. Select the output waveform range through the 4*4 keyboard: three models of sine wave, square wave and triangle wave can be set

Watch the video for a detailed introduction to the specific test method. . .

 

To learn more, please watch the video explanation. . .

Guess you like

Origin blog.csdn.net/LS840233684/article/details/127663504